
BODY {
	margin: 0px;
	padding: 0px;
	background: #ffffff;
	font-family: Verdana, Tahoma, Arial, Helvetica, sans-serif;
	font-size: 9px;
	text-align: center;
	color: #57574c;
}
TD {
	font-family: Verdana, Tahoma,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#111111;
}

INPUT.button { font-family: Verdana, Arial, Helvetica, sans-serif; COLOR: #000000; BORDER: #C8C8C8 1px solid; BACKGROUND-COLOR: #0099ff; FONT-SIZE: 11px; }

.field {
	font-family: Verdana, Arial, Helvetica, sans-serif; COLOR: #777777; FONT-SIZE: 11px;
	BORDER: #C8C8C8 1px solid; BACKGROUND-COLOR: #ffffff;
}
.field_on {
	font-family: Verdana, Arial, Helvetica, sans-serif; COLOR: #61717a; FONT-SIZE: 11px;
	BORDER: #61717a 1px solid; BACKGROUND-COLOR: #ffffff;
}

a {
	text-decoration: none;
	color: #0099ff;
}
a:hover {
	text-decoration: underline;
}

.top-line {
	background: url(top-bar-grad.jpg) repeat-x;
	font-size: 15px;
	color: #494949;
	font-weight: bold;
	position:relative;
	vertical-align:top;
	top:4px;
}
.top-line a {
	text-decoration: none;
	color: #ffffff;
}
.top-line a:hover {
	text-decoration: underline;
}
.motto
{
   position:absolute;
   left:30%;
   width:50%;
   top:120px;
   font-family:"Plantagenet Cherokee";
   font-size:24px;
   font-style:italic;
   color:#0762E4;
}
.mottoIE
{
   position:absolute;
   left:30%;
   width:50%;
   top:120px;
   font-family:"Plantagenet Cherokee";
   font-size:24px;
   font-style:italic;
   color:#0762E4;
}
.mottoPagPrincipala
{
   position:absolute;
   left:30%;
   width:50%;
   top:120px;
   font-family:"Plantagenet Cherokee";
   font-size:24px;
   font-style:italic;
   color:#0762E4;
}
.mottoIEPagPrincipala
{
   position:absolute;
   left:30%;
   width:50%;
   top:120px;
   font-family:"Plantagenet Cherokee";
   font-size:24px;
   font-style:italic;
   color:#0762E4;
}
.timer{
    position:relative;
	
}
.title {
	font-family: Verdana, Tahoma, Arial, Helvetica, sans-serif;
	font-size: 15px;
	font-weight: normal;
	color: #ebebeb;
	text-align: left;
	vertical-align: top;
}
.stitle {
	font-size: 13px;
	color: #016eff;
	font-weight: bold;
       text-align:left;
}
.content {
	font-size: 12px;
	color: #111111;
	text-align: justify;
	vertical-align: top;
	padding: 15px 15px 15px 15px;
}
.aud
{
   position:relative;
   bottom:60px;
}
.content td {
	font-size: 12px;
	color: #111111;
}
.content a {
	text-decoration: none;
	color: #016eff;
}
.content a:hover {
	text-decoration: underline;
}

.page-lines {
	background-color: #006aff;
}
.page-lines2 {
	background-color: #d65b00;
}

.smenu .btn {
	background: url(ap-line.jpg) repeat-y center;
	height: 55px;
	vertical-align: bottom;
}
.smenu .sbtnl {
	background: url(ap-line.jpg) repeat-y center;
	height: 10px;
}
.smenu .btn2 {
	background: url(ap-line-big.jpg) repeat-y center;
	height: 55px;
	vertical-align: bottom;
}
.smenu .sbtnl2 {
	background: url(ap-line-big.jpg) repeat-y center;
	height: 10px;
}
.ssmenu {
     
}
.tline {
	background: url(smenus-line.jpg) no-repeat center;
	height: 10px;
	margin: 7px 5px 7px 5px;
}
.tlineCom {
	background: url(smenus-line.jpg) no-repeat center;
	height: 10px;
	margin: 0px 0px 0px 0px;
}

.ssmenu .tline {
	background: url(smenus-line.jpg) repeat-y center;
	height: 10px;
	margin: 0px;
}
.ssmenu .tline2 {
	background: url(smenus-line2.jpg) repeat-y center;
	height: 10px;
	margin: 0px;
}
.ssmenu .spacer {
	width: 7px;
}
.ssmenu .btn {
	background: url(ap-line.jpg) repeat-y center;
	height: 35px;
	vertical-align: bottom;
}
.ssmenu .btn2 {
	background: url(ap-line-big.jpg) repeat-y center;
	height: 35px;
	vertical-align: bottom;
}

.thread .title {
	font-size: 13px;
	font-weight: bold;
}
.thread .bg1 {
	background-color: #ffffff;
}
.thread .bg2 {
	background-color: #d6ecfa;
}
.post td {
	font-size: 12px;
}

.post .title {
	font-weight: bold;
	font-size: 15px;
	color: #111111;
}
.post .date {
	font-size: 11px;
}
.post .name {
	font-weight: bold;
	font-size: 12px;
	color:#555555;
}
.post .text {
	font-size: 14px;
}
.post .answ {
	font-size: 14px;
}

.right .box {
	background-color: #ffffff;
	border: #FFFFFF solid 0px 1px 2px 1px;
}
.right .box .title {
	background-color: #0099ff;
	text-align: center;
	vertical-align: top;
}

.left .box {
	background: #ffffff url(leftbox-bg.jpg);
}
.left .box .title {
	text-align: center;
	vertical-align: top;
}
.left .box .content {
	text-align: center;
	vertical-align: middle;
	background: url(leftbox-bottom.jpg) no-repeat center bottom;
	padding-left: 3px;
	padding-right:3px;
	padding-top:3px;
	padding-bottom:5px;
}

.right .box2 {
	background-color: #ffffff;
	border: #FFFFFF solid 0px 1px 2px 1px;
}
.right .box2 .title {
	background-color: #ee9106;
	text-align: center;
	vertical-align: top;
}

.sondaj {
	font-family: Verdana, Tahoma, Arial, Helvetica, sans-serif;
	font-size: 9px;
	color: #57574c;
}
.sondaj .question a{
	font-size: 14px;
	color: #f68c00;
	font-weight: bold;
	text-decoration:none;
}
.sondaj .answer {
}
.sondaj .perc {
	font-weight: bold;
}
.sondaj .bar {
	background-color: #0099ff;
}
.sondaj .bar1 {
	background-color: #428bf8;
}
.sondaj .bar2 {
	background-color: #ef3232;
}
.sondaj .bar3 {
	background-color: #efc92e;
}


.box a { font-weight: bold; text-decoration: none; color:blue; }
.box a:hover { font-weight: bold; text-decoration: underline; color: #0099ff; }
.box a:visited { font-weight: bold; text-decoration: underline; color:purple; }
.box a.current { font-weight: bold; text-decoration: none; color: #0076c5; }
.box a.current:hover { font-weight: bold; text-decoration: underline; color: #0099ff; }
.box .bg1 { background-color: #ffffff; }
.box .bg2 { background-color: #d6ecfa; }


.bls
{
 padding: 20px 18px 0px 0px;
 background: none;
}
.bls0
{
 padding: 20px 18px 0px 0px;
 background: url(btn-line.jpg) no-repeat right bottom;
}
.bls1
{
 padding: 20px 18px 0px 0px;
 background: url(btn-line-big1.jpg) no-repeat right bottom;
}
.bls2
{
 padding: 20px 18px 0px 0px;
 background: url(btn-line-big2.jpg) no-repeat right bottom;
}
.footer 
{
  position:relative;
  background : transparent;
  background-color:#036db7;
  
  

  
  
  
  
}
.error
{
   color:#19D70B;
   margin-left:5px;
   font-weight:bold;
   font-size:12px;
}
.errorBig
{
  color:red ;
   margin-left:5px;
   font-weight:bold;
   font-size:12px;

}
.imgFooter
{
   border:0;
   height="114"; 
   position:relative;
   top:1px;
   width:200px;
   right:60px;
}
div.pagination {
	padding: 3px;
	margin: 3px;
}

div.pagination a {
	padding: 2px 5px 2px 5px;
	margin: 2px;
	border: 1px solid #AAAADD;
	
	text-decoration: none; /* no underline */
	color: #000099;
}
div.pagination a:hover, div.pagination a:active {
	border: 1px solid #000099;

	color: #000;
}
div.pagination span.current {
	padding: 2px 5px 2px 5px;
	margin: 2px;
		border: 1px solid #0068ff;
		
		font-weight: bold;
		background-color: #000099;
		color: #5dbfff;
	}
	div.pagination span.disabled {
		padding: 2px 5px 2px 5px;
		margin: 2px;
		border: 1px solid #ec8703;
	
		color: #f7a40a;
	}
.down{
    position:relative;


	width:75px;
	border: 2px solid #ffc876;
	height:80px;
}	
.rightBox
{
   color:#56a8fa;
   text-decoration:none;
}
.jos
{
    font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#FFFFFF;
	
}